    i don't think it's catholics that bring it into question, it's usually the backwoods pentecostal folks and islamic people in the middle east. hell, the catholics even came out in saying that aliens could exist. pop francis talks about maybe the big bang being the genesis event(which is something i've considered possible for a very long time now).

    but yes, they existed. the problem is that we don't entirely know what whole dinosaurs looked like, because complete skeletons are incredibly rare. some were patched together from different animals, and that created things like the brachiosaurus, and some were misidentified as a separated but related species, when it was actually just a younger member of the same species like the triceratops.

    Fossils aren't bone at all.
    Sigh...you got me, it's all over.

    The fossil has the same shape as the original object, but is chemically more like a rock! Some of the original hydroxy-apatite (a major bone consitiuent) remains, although it is saturated with silica (rock).
